Overview

Nihon Dengi is a specialist firm in the construction industry founded in 1959, specializing in the design and construction of air conditioning automatic control systems, and has built a solid position in the industry with its proprietary technologies and services for large buildings.

Current Situation

Nihon Dengi possesses high technical expertise in air conditioning automatic control systems for large commercial facilities and office buildings in recent years, backed by numerous achievements. Sales are stable, and the management and maintenance business is expanding. To differentiate from competitors, it focuses on IoT technology adoption and energy efficiency improvements. For sustainability, it aims to reduce environmental impact through proactive proposals and support for energy-saving systems. Its mid-to-long-term strategy involves shifting to next-generation air conditioning controls leveraging AI and data analytics while addressing smart building market growth. In 2024, it began developing new solutions to expand market share. It emphasizes human resource development to nurture and secure advanced engineers. Recovering from the pandemic, it flexibly adapts to rising construction demand and market changes.
